Quote:
Originally Posted by Rellwood View Post
Was the comments missing in the book details panel solved? I set it to horizontal after vertical didn't show them. Still not showing them. Tried looking up the "floating" option in look and feel and couldn't find it. I do know that it is floating -when it was in vertical-not sure if that option was removed when I set it to horizontal. Either way, no comments in the panel.

Running 3.99.2.msi
That was a red-herring, theducks didn't scroll down - try setting Preferences->Look & Feel->How to display text in the 'Narrow' layout: to Columns
